The treatment of dog bleeding

Some minor scratches, stabbing, etc., the amount of bleeding is generally not a lot, so we don't have to panic too much. As long as the operation is proper and does not cause infection, the wound will heal soon; if the wound is very deep, then you need to do a good job of treatment and then take it to the hospital for further treatment. When dealing with the wound for the dog, it is best to wear disposable gloves to avoid pollution to the dog's wound.

1. Usually you can make a little disinfection cotton ball at home. If the wound is not very large, then pour the hydrogen peroxide into a container, and then put the cotton ball in the hydrogen peroxide. Then clean the wound with a cotton ball. After cleaning, wipe the surroundings with a clean towel, and then apply a little iodine. Because it is a small wound, there will not be too much blood, and the blood will solidifies to prevent continuing bleeding by itself.

2. Let the dog lie down and improve the wounds, cover the wound with a disinfection dressing, press it with your hand on the dressing, apply appropriate pressure to help stop bleeding. Usually less severe bleeding (such as accidental injuries) can stop bleeding in about 20 seconds. If it is a scratch wound, because the blood is not flowing out, it is exuded, and there is no need to raise the wounded limbs to stop bleeding.

3. If there is no blood exudation on the dressing after bandaging, you can think that the wound has basically stopped blood. At this time, use a tape to fix the dressing.

4. Method of bleeding in special parts:

Head: If you just rub bleeding slightly, you don't have to worry too much. However, if it is impacted by strong impact, it must be sent to the hospital for examination after hemostasis, is there any problem with the internal.

If it is violently impacted, even if there is no bleeding, it is necessary to send it to the hospital for examination.

Nosebleed: Let the dog rest quietly. For a small amount of nasal hemorrhage, keep the dog's head horizontally or slightly raising the mouth and nose, and apply cold compresses on the forehead and nose bridge. Generally, you can stop bleeding after a few minutes. For bleeding, the nasal cavity can drop 1: 50,000 adrenaline solution or fill the nasal cavity with a gauze with analgesic solution. When the amount of bleeding is large, when the wound bleeding is spray -like or bright red blood, immediately use cleaning the finger to compress the blood flow above the blood flow point to interrupt the blood flow, and raise the bleeding limbs to reduce the bleeding to reduce the bleeding. quantity. When a hemostatic band hemostasis, the soft cloth several layers should be used to cushion under the hemostatic zone. Do not use the hemostatic band 1/3 of the upper arm and under the armpit to avoid damage to the nerves. Immediately after the hemostatic effect has a certain effect, take the car to the dog to the hospital for emergency treatment.

Sometimes the dog is strongly impacted, and it may not have any blood, and there is no adverse symptoms for a while. However, we must take the dog for further examination to prevent internal bleeding.
